Snakes of the Southeast!

Daniel Parker from Sunshine Serpents will be doing a Powerpoint presentation on
Snakes of the Southeast

"Was that a water snake or a cottonmouth? A scarlet king snake or a coral snake? Daniel Parker of Sunshine Serpents and University of Central Florida gives a general overview of the snake species of the southeastern United States with an emphasis on identification, conservation, and venomous snake safety. This presentation will include a colorful powerpoint presentation and live snakes."

Vet Checks for Your Animals


-Fecal exams done for $10 each on premises.
 
-Fecal exams done only during show hours (Dr. Alfonso will stop doing fecals 1/2 hour before closing if the demand is high to allow for closing)
 
-Fecal exams are only to help the owners determine treatment course, not a reason to return reptiles to a vendor.
 
-Reptiles routinely harbor parasites and the purpose of the fecal exams is not to dicourage purchases but rather treat them promptly.
 
-Fecal samples must be fresh, no older than 12 hours when possible (in the case of people bringing samples of their pets at home).
 
-Only reptile/amphibian samples will be processed. No other species will be seen.
 
-The fecal exam is a fecal float only. No smears will be done on premises. Each fecal float takes approx. 10 minutes to run so time will be limited.
 
-On Saturday, tests will start at 12:00 PM when Dr. Alfonso arrives at the show. On Sunday it will be from opening time.
 
-Owners with animals having parasites will be told the parasite present, which medication is recommended for treatment, and where to go for medications (Dr. Alfonso's clinic or any of their choice).
